  • Murphy the bald eagle first began nesting with a rock in March 2023. But what seemed like a quirky habit became an asset to the World Bird Sanctuary when an orphaned eaglet was in need of care. Murphy is the first bald eagle to become a foster parent at the sanctuary.

    Not mentioned is that they had to put the eaglet under a safety cage for a week when they swapped it with the rock, just in case Murphy felt hostile to the chick. After Murphy took to feeding the eaglet and responding positively to its cries, the sanctuary removed the cage and allowed Murphy to fully assume foster father duties.

    In the wild, if a female Bald eagle of a pair goes missing or dies, the males have been known to continue hunting and provide food and care to eaglets. If the young birds are close to or fledged, it increases the chances that the father can help them survive to reach self-sufficiency.
    Murphy as a foster parent to a younger chick, which typically would not survive, provides an excellent opportunity for the rescue community to learn about this species and how to help a family if a parent becomes unable to do so.
